About the role
- Functional requirements development and ownership
- Work with stakeholders to understand business requirements, map key processes, understand pain points
- Assess and improve upon potential business processes that need review to more efficiently migrate to Salesforce.com
- Work closely with IT team to act as the voice of the customer and provide feedback on requirements and functionality
- Support the business by applying cross functional subject matter expertise of business processes, systems, and integration to facilitate continuous improvement and innovation
- Coordinate with the Salesforce admin team to design the functionality in SFDC
- UAT testing management and hypercare support
- Work closely with development team and core project team to produce product documentation including user guides, test scripts, and internal/external materials
- Ability to describe complex concepts with the appropriate amount of detail based on audience
- Support the field in answering questions. Provide key details to learning business partner for training materials related to functionality
- User adoption management
- Develop strategies and plans to drive end user adoption and optimization
- Manage KPI and tools supporting change management and user adoption, providing a clear picture to stakeholders on change process and continued focal areas that may need additional support
- Ability to describe complex concepts with the appropriate amount of detail based on audience
- Capturing key details of the process and work with training to incorporate into user guides that support the end user experience and training strategy
- Training change network to become subject matter experts and provide support to them as they work to train the business end users
